Item
8.01. Other Events.
As
previously disclosed, on June 5, 2022, Bright Green Corporation (the “Company”) and LDS Capital LLC (“LDS”),
whose managing member is Lynn Stockwell, a member of the Company’s board of directors, entered into an unsecured line of credit
in the form of a note, which provided that the Company could borrow up to $5 million from LDS, which amount was increased to $10 million
on November 14, 2022 (as amended, the “Note”). On January 31, 2023, LDS assigned the Note to Ms. Stockwell (the “Lender”).
As
of August 31, 2023, all amounts of principal interests and other costs under the Note were $3,619,788.94 (the “Repayment Obligation”).
In connection with the Repayment Obligation, on September 1, 2023, the Company and the Lender entered into an agreement (the “Agreement”)
pursuant to which, in consideration for the cancellation and full satisfaction of the Repayment Obligation, the Company issued to the
Lender (i) 2,827,960 shares (the “Shares”) of the Company’s common stock, par value $0.0001 per share (the “Common
Stock”), representing a conversion of outstanding principal at $1.15 per Share, and (ii) warrants representing a conversion of
outstanding principal at $0.13 per warrant (the “Warrants”) to purchase up to 2,827,960 shares of Common Stock (the “Warrant
Shares”) at a price of $3.00 per share.
The
Warrants are exercisable immediately upon issuance, and shall expire on the earlier of (i) the date that is 45 days after the date on
which closing price of the Common Stock on the Nasdaq Capital Market equals or exceeds $3.00 per share, and (ii) August 31, 2024.
Notwithstanding
the Agreement, the Note remains in full force and effect, and the Company may, upon approval from the Lender, draw down additional funds
under the unsecured line of credit, in accordance with its terms.
The
Shares, Warrants and Warrant Shares were or will be issued without registration under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ities
Act”), in reliance on the exemptions provided by Section 4(a)(2) of the Securities Act as transactions not involving a public offering
and Rule 506 of Regulation D promulgated under the Securities Act as issuances to accredited investors, and in reliance on similar exemptions
under applicable state laws.

Bright
Green Announces Agreement to Settle Debt in Shares at a Premium
The
Company has settled a $3.6 million related party loan, representing all outstanding indebtedness, in shares of common stock and warrants,
valued at $1.28 per share and accompanying warrant
GRANTS,
N.M., September 5th, 2023 – Bright Green Corporation (Nasdaq: BGXX) (“Bright Green” or “the Company”),
one of few companies selected by the U.S. government to grow, manufacture, and sell, legally under federal and state laws, cannabis and
cannabis-related products for research, pharmaceutical applications and affiliated export, is pleased to announce that it has entered
into an Agreement to pay down the Company’s outstanding indebtedness (the “Note”) with the Company’s founder,
largest shareholder, and member of the Board of Directors (“Lender”), effective September 1, 2023.
Under
the terms of the Agreement, the $3.6 million outstanding balance of the Note was cancelled and the Company’s obligations thereunder
were satisfied in full. In consideration, the Company issued Lender 2,827,960 unregistered shares of common stock, and unregistered warrants
to purchase up to 2,827,960 shares of common stock at an exercise price of $3.00 per share. Each share of common stock was issued together
with one warrant at a combined effective conversion price of $1.28 per share and related warrant ($1.15 per share and $0.13 per warrant).
The
conversion price of $1.15 per share represents a 246% premium to the August 31st closing market price of the Company’s common stock.
The
warrants may be exercised at any time, in whole or in part, and expire on the earlier of (i) the 45th day after the closing price per
share of Common Stock is $3.00 or greater or (ii) August 31, 2024.
Notwithstanding
the cancellation of the outstanding balance under the Note, the Note will remain in full force and effect, and the Company may borrow
up to $15 million from Lender at the Company’s election, pursuant to the terms and subject to the conditions set forth in the Note.
